Trip Odometer - Resets to Zero
File In Section: 08 - Body and Accessories
Bulletin No.: 99-08-49-012
Date: September, 1999
TECHNICAL
Subject:
Trip Odometer Resets (Install Diode)
Models:
1998 Chevrolet Cavalier
with Compressed Natural Gas (CNG) fuel option
Condition
Some customers may comment that the trip odometer resets to zero.
Cause
The CNG vehicle's fuel system electrical components back feed, with 12 volts, Circuit # 1020 for several seconds after key off. This voltage disrupts
communication between the PCM and the I/P cluster and the trip odometer mileage information is lost before it is stored in the memory of the PCM.
Correction
Install the diode assembly; P/N 52369504, using the following procedure:
1.
Remove the secondary lock (comb) from the diode assembly and save for reuse.
2.
Find the grey 10 way connector (1), located between the radiator and where the radiator hose attaches to the engine.
3.
Separate the grey 10 way connector and remove the comb from the connector top half (the one with the female terminals).
4.
Using the terminal removal tool, GM 12094429, remove the pink wire from cavity C of the grey 10 way connector.
5.
Insert the pink wire, removed in the previous step, into cavity B of the diode assembly connector and reinstall the comb.
6.
Insert the pink wire from cavity C of the diode assembly into cavity C of the 10 way connector and reinstall the comb.
7.
Reconnect both halves of the 10 way connector.
8.
Attach the diode assembly to the side of the 10 way connector, using a plastic tie strap or tape.
9.
Remove the ground stud nut from the top forward transaxle to the engine mounting bolt and slip the diode assembly wire eyelet over the stud and
reinstall the nut.
